LSE Automatic Customer Prompt for Business Central
LSE Automatic Customer Prompt for Business Central

LSE Automatic Customer Prompt for Business Central automatically opens the customer list page with each new sale in LS Express. The customer selected from the list is applied to the current sale.

System Requirements

  • LS Express POS.
  • The FactBox pane on the right side of LS Express POS must be open.

Using the Extension

Starting a New Sale

  1. Start LS Express POS.
  2. Make sure the FactBox pane on the right side of LS Express POS is open.
  3. Allow the FactBox to finish loading.
  4. Begin a new sale.

Automatic Customer List Conditions

After LS Express starts and the FactBox loads, the extension checks both of the following conditions:

  1. The currently selected customer is a default customer configured for the LS Express store.
  2. The current sale total is 0.

When both conditions are true, the customer list opens automatically.

Selecting the Customer

  1. Select the appropriate customer from the customer list.
  2. The selected customer is applied to the current sale.
  3. Continue processing the sale.

Troubleshooting

The Customer List Does Not Open

Verify the following documented conditions:

  • The FactBox pane is open on the right side of LS Express POS.
  • The FactBox has finished loading.
  • The currently selected customer is a default customer configured for the LS Express store.
  • The current sale total is 0.

The customer list opens automatically only when both customer and sale-total conditions are true.
